Closed Bug 1014443 Opened 11 years ago Closed 11 years ago

buildbot master's pulse queue is full and filled up /dev/shm.

Categories

(SeaMonkey :: Release Engineering, defect)

x86
Linux
defect
Not set
blocker

Tracking

(Not tracked)

RESOLVED FIXED

People

(Reporter: ewong, Assigned: ewong)

References

Details

sea-master1's pulse log has filled up. +++ This bug was initially created as a clone of Bug #831145 +++ The SeaMonkey buildbot master twistd.log contains: 2013-01-15 20:02:05-0800 [buildbot.status.web.baseweb.RotateLogSite] Could not accept new connection (EMFILE) 2013-01-15 20:02:05-0800 [twisted.spread.pb.PBServerFactory] Could not accept new connection (EMFILE) and it repeats. Going into /proc/<pid>/fd there are a lot of entries: (an example) lrwx------ 1 seabld seabld 64 Jan 15 20:23 975 -> /dev/shm/queue/pulse/tmp/1358218872-2172-15703QkoKOI lrwx------ 1 seabld seabld 64 Jan 15 20:23 976 -> /dev/shm/queue/pulse/tmp/1358218872-2172-15703cN3Fsr lrwx------ 1 seabld seabld 64 Jan 15 20:23 977 -> /dev/shm/queue/pulse/tmp/1358218872-2172-157039um5Xu lrwx------ 1 seabld seabld 64 Jan 15 20:23 978 -> /dev/shm/queue/pulse/tmp/1358218872-2172-157033L2ayj lrwx------ 1 seabld seabld 64 Jan 15 20:23 979 -> /dev/shm/queue/pulse/tmp/1358218872-2172-15703XVHD7g lrwx------ 1 seabld seabld 64 Jan 15 20:23 98 -> /dev/shm/queue/pulse/tmp/1358218872-2172-15703aguZ_I lrwx------ 1 seabld seabld 64 Jan 15 20:23 980 -> /dev/shm/queue/pulse/tmp/1358218872-2172-15703CWqU5w lrwx------ 1 seabld seabld 64 Jan 15 20:23 981 -> /dev/shm/queue/pulse/tmp/1358218872-2172-157034mKICI lrwx------ 1 seabld seabld 64 Jan 15 20:23 982 -> /dev/shm/queue/pulse/tmp/1358218872-2172-157034KKooR lrwx------ 1 seabld seabld 64 Jan 15 20:23 983 -> /dev/shm/queue/pulse/tmp/1358218872-2172-15703fWbDUq lrwx------ 1 seabld seabld 64 Jan 15 20:23 984 -> /dev/shm/queue/pulse/tmp/1358218872-2172-15703nPj2IV lrwx------ 1 seabld seabld 64 Jan 15 20:23 987 -> /dev/shm/queue/pulse/tmp/1358218872-2172-15703QUFmnP lrwx------ 1 seabld seabld 64 Jan 15 20:23 988 -> /dev/shm/queue/pulse/tmp/1358218872-2172-15703D7LsO9 lrwx------ 1 seabld seabld 64 Jan 15 20:23 989 -> /dev/shm/queue/pulse/tmp/1358218872-2172-1570342Di_r lrwx------ 1 seabld seabld 64 Jan 15 20:23 99 -> /dev/shm/queue/pulse/tmp/1358218872-2172-15703pkb5UT lrwx------ 1 seabld seabld 64 Jan 15 20:23 990 -> /dev/shm/queue/pulse/tmp/1358218872-2172-15703LGADGX lrwx------ 1 seabld seabld 64 Jan 15 20:23 991 -> /dev/shm/queue/pulse/tmp/1358218872-2172-15703dfRJ4r lrwx------ 1 seabld seabld 64 Jan 15 20:23 992 -> /dev/shm/queue/pulse/tmp/1358218872-2172-15703HPmNu4 lrwx------ 1 seabld seabld 64 Jan 15 20:23 993 -> /dev/shm/queue/pulse/tmp/1358218872-2172-15703gu90ZF lrwx------ 1 seabld seabld 64 Jan 15 20:23 994 -> /dev/shm/queue/pulse/tmp/1358218872-2172-157033MsTtw lrwx------ 1 seabld seabld 64 Jan 15 20:23 995 -> /dev/shm/queue/pulse/tmp/1358218872-2172-15703on31Ya lrwx------ 1 seabld seabld 64 Jan 15 20:23 996 -> /dev/shm/queue/pulse/tmp/1358218872-2172-15703pnWCHE lrwx------ 1 seabld seabld 64 Jan 15 20:23 999 -> /dev/shm/queue/pulse/tmp/1358218872-2172-15703yTB0aJ thus our tmpfs: tmpfs 1037876 1037876 0 100% /dev/shm My first guess is something to do with pulse.
Running the following: /builds/buildbot/master01/bin/python2.7 /builds/buildbot/master01/tools/buildbot-helpers/pulse_publisher.py --passwords <passwordfile>
Once completed, I rebooted sea-master1. It's now back up and looks good. Waiting until all slaves have connected to the master before closing this.
All slaves attached (aside for sea-win32-01, which is down due to hw issues.)
Status: ASSIGNED → RESOLVED
Closed: 11 years ago
Resolution: --- → FIXED
You need to log in before you can comment on or make changes to this bug.